Hidden sins

Have you ever noticed people that have hid their sins and sin is only brought to light because of an act of God that person either fully repents or their repentance is insincere and that sin comes back over and over to haunt them until they are destroyed...
I have been talking to some today about insincere repentance...people that repent because it is convenient...the right thing to do at the moment…
Those same people if they do not fully repent are destroyed because they fellowship with people in the same boat…I read today David’s repentance Psalm to a person in my office…
I have had that on my mind. It is so sad to see the devil trick people and make them believe all is well when they are really dying spiritually.

Sis Alvear,

I do believe that people with the same 'weights' and 'sins' that they struggle with are drawn together for many reasons. They pick up on the language, the signals, the symptoms if you would.

It is my personal experience that I can be repentant, truly repentant about something and when I am weak or in a vulnerable position the devil brings the same trigger to put me into a place of temptation. There have been many times I have fallen back into the 'issue'/'sin' only to have to repent again.

There is a time that you have to get to the point that you are aware of the triggers, look for the pitfall, and find the escape route that God has promised. It you take the escape route time and again then it will truly become a thing of the past and you will not be tempted by or succomb to it any longer.

There are spirits attached to certain sins, especially sexual sins. This is why it is very difficult for those caught in homosexuality, pedophilia, beastiality, necromancy, and adultery and fornication to be free from it. One must live a submitted and disciplined life to fight these spiritual battles and be victorious.

For those who have never struggled with any sexual sin, this might not be something you can understand or even forgive others for without putting on your cloak of self-righteousness. For those that have struggled and won...they can empathize and be armour-bearers for those who struggle with the same demons.
